The Science Behind Body Temperature

Your normal body temperature isn’t actually a fixed number. It fluctuates throughout the day, typically ranging from 97°F to 99°F (36.1°C to 37.2°C). Various factors influence your temperature, including physical activity, time of day, hormonal changes, and even what you’ve eaten or drunk recently.

Understanding these natural variations helps you better interpret thermometer readings and recognize when a temperature truly indicates illness. Modern digital thermometers account for these variations and provide more accurate baseline measurements than their analog predecessors.

Digital Ear Thermometers: Quick and Reliable

Ear thermometers, also known as tympanic thermometers, measure temperature by detecting infrared energy emitted by the eardrum. They’re incredibly fast – most provide readings in just a few seconds. The ear canal’s proximity to the brain makes it an excellent location for getting core body temperature readings.

These thermometers are especially useful for active individuals or those who have difficulty keeping traditional thermometers in place. They’re also great for healthcare providers and caregivers who need quick, accurate readings multiple times throughout the day.

Traditional Digital Oral Thermometers: The Trusted Standard

While they may seem old-fashioned compared to their high-tech cousins, digital oral thermometers remain the gold standard for accuracy. They work by using electronic heat sensors to measure body temperature when placed under the tongue, in the armpit, or rectally.

Modern versions heat up incredibly fast – most provide accurate readings within 10-20 seconds. They’re reliable, affordable, and familiar to most people, making them excellent additions to any Health Assistance Aids collection.

Thermometer Type Reading Time Accuracy Level Best Use Cases Contact Required
Infrared Forehead 1-3 seconds High Sleeping patients, quick screening No
Digital Ear 2-5 seconds Very High Active children, quick checks Minimal
Digital Oral 10-20 seconds Excellent Accurate baseline readings Yes
Smart Thermometer 5-15 seconds Excellent Data tracking, family monitoring Varies

Proper Positioning Techniques

Each type of thermometer has optimal positioning requirements. For forehead thermometers, ensure you’re measuring on clean, dry skin away from hairlines. For ear thermometers, proper ear canal alignment is crucial for accuracy.

Take time to read the manufacturer’s instructions and practice proper technique. Most modern thermometers provide clear guidance on correct positioning, and many include visual guides or positioning aids.

Understanding Reading Variations

Different measurement sites (forehead, ear, oral) can produce slightly different readings, and this is normal. Understanding these variations helps you interpret results correctly and avoid unnecessary anxiety over minor temperature differences.

Consistency is key – try to use the same measurement method and device for tracking temperature changes over time, especially when monitoring illness progression or recovery.
